Show HN: Hydra 1.0 – open-source column-oriented Postgres
it depends on your query obviously.
In general, I did very deep benchmarking of pg, clickhouse and duckdb, and I sure didn't make stupid mistakes like this: https://news.ycombinator.com/item?id=36990831
My dataset has 50B rows and 2tb of data, and I think columnar dbs are very overhiped and I chose pg because:
- pg performance is acceptable, maybe 2-3x times slower than clickhouse and duckdb on some queries if pg is configured correctly and run on compressed storage
- clickhouse and duckdb start falling apart very fast because they specialized on very narrow type of queries: https://github.com/ClickHouse/ClickHouse/issues/47520 https://github.com/ClickHouse/ClickHouse/issues/47521 https://github.com/duckdb/duckdb/discussions/6696

> This works really well if your problem can be solved in one or two liners.
My personal comfort threshold is around the 100-line mark. It's even possible to write maintainable shell scripts up to 500 lines, but it mostly depends on the problem you're trying to solve, and the discipline of the programmer to follow best practices (use sane defaults, ShellCheck, etc.).
> It go bad very quickly when, say, you have two CSV files and want to join them the sql-way.
In that case we're talking about structured data, and, yeah, Perl or Python would be easier to work with. That said, depending on the complexity of the CSV, you can still go a long way with plain Bash with IFS/read(1) or tr(1) to split CSV columns. This wouldn't be very robust, but there are tools that handle CSV specifically[1], which can be composed in a shell script just fine.
So it's always a balancing act of being productive quickly with a shell script, or reaching out for a programming language once the tools aren't a good fit, or maintenance becomes an issue.
